Income Deprivation

The Income Deprivation Domain measures the proportion of the population in and around Ravensdale Drive experiencing deprivation relating to low income.
Residents in around Ravensdale Drive are in the top 20% least income deprived in the country.

Employment Deprivation

The Employment Deprivation Domain measures the proportion of working-age residents in and around Ravensdale Drive involuntarily excluded from the labour market. This includes the unemployed, those who are sick or disabled, or have caring responsibilities.
Residents in Ravensdale Drive are in the top 30% least employment deprived in the country

Health & Disability Deprivation

The Health Deprivation and Disability Domain measures the risk of premature death and the impairment of quality of life through poor physical or mental health. This does not include aspects of behaviour or the environment that may be lead to predicted future health and disability problems.
Residents in Ravensdale Drive are in the top 30% least health & disability deprived in the country

Index of Multiple Deprivation

The Index of Multiple Deprivation (IMD) is an overall relative measure of deprivation constructed by combining seven measures of deprivation. It encapsulates a broad socio-economic view of Ravensdale Drive, from outside living quality, housing quality, access to services and crime.
Residents in Ravensdale Drive are in the top 10% least deprived in the country
